Efficient modulation of of γ-aminobutyric acid type A (GABAA) receptors by piperine derivatives [PDF]
[Image: see text] Piperine activates TRPV1 (transient receptor potential vanilloid type 1 receptor) receptors and modulates γ-aminobutyric acid type A receptors (GABA(A)R). We have synthesized a library of 76 piperine analogues and analyzed their effects

The energy sensor OsSnRK1a confers broad-spectrum disease resistance in rice [PDF]
Sucrose non-fermenting-1-related protein kinase-1 (SnRK1) belongs to a family of evolutionary conserved kinases with orthologs in all eukaryotes, ranging from yeasts (SnF1) to mammals (AMP-Activated kinase).

New Insights on Plant Cell Elongation: A Role for Acetylcholine [PDF]
We investigated the effect of auxin and acetylcholine on the expression of the tomato expansin gene LeEXPA2, a specific expansin gene expressed in elongating tomato hypocotyl segments.

The role of ubiquitination in health and disease
Ubiquitination regulates protein degradation, trafficking, and signaling through a complex machinery involving ubiquitin and various ligases. It is crucial for protein homeostasis, DNA repair, cell cycle regulation, and immune responses. Dysregulation leads to diseases like cancer and neurodegenerative disorders.
